it restarted.  Some attributes:

Abstract processes:
- are purely descriptive (similar to WSDL)
- know and say nothing about the implementation of the underlying service(s)
- do not require an implementation based on executable BPEL

The relationship between abstract interfaces and implementations are such
that:
- Multiple implementations are allowed and indeed expected
- Multiple abstract processes can exist for a single executable
